    Site-Specific Energy Assessment

    Fine-tune performance with custom energy modeling that transforms your roof's reality—sun hours, tilt, azimuth, shading, module temperature, and local weather—into a accurate production forecast. We combine satellite irradiance, field sensor data, and historic CHWK climate normals to calculate yield across seasons. Our microclimate analysis incorporates valley fog, orographic rainfall, and temperature swings that influence cell efficiency and inverter clipping. A detailed shading assessment documents hourly losses from trees, dormers, and nearby structures using LiDAR and horizon profiles. We model temperature coefficients, snow persistence, soiling rates, and DC/AC ratios to refine system sizing and energy confidence intervals. You'll get bankable outputs: monthly kWh projections, performance tolerance bands, degradation curves, and financial impacts, so you can decide with evidence—not guesses.

    High-Quality Panel Systems and Tested Installation Methods

    Since long-term performance relies on smart component choices, focus on Tier 1, UL/CSA-certified modules with high efficiency (20–23%+), reduced annual degradation rates (≤0.5%/yr), and robust 25–30 year performance warranties. You'll maximize output and protect ROI with panel durability validated through IEC 61215/61730 testing and tight manufacturing standards that confirm cell quality, lamination integrity, and PID resistance.

    Combine premium modules with proven installation methods. Insist on racking engineered to CSA A370/ASCE 7 wind and snow loads, corrosion-resistant fasteners, and flashed, torque-specified penetrations that maintain your roof warranty. Insist on NEC/CEC-compliant wiring, AFCI/rapid shutdown, and properly sized conductors to minimize voltage drop. Select inverters with ≥97% CEC efficiency and documented MTBF data. Finally, demand commissioning reports: IV-curve traces, insulation resistance, thermal imaging, and production baselines to validate performance on day one.

    Can Solar Be Integrated With Existing Backup Generators?

    Yes—you can integrate solar with existing backup generators. You'll require generator compatibility verification, a properly sized transfer switch, and a hybrid inverter that supports AC-coupling. We evaluate generator frequency stability, automatic start/stop signaling, and load prioritization to eliminate backfeed. Research indicates integrated controls cut fuel use by 40 to 60 percent during outages. We'll size batteries correctly, determine charge priorities, and program backup modes so your generator runs only when solar and storage can't meet demand.

    Which Roofing Types Are Incompatible with Solar in Chilliwack?

    Like shoes on ice, some roofs don't grip solar well. In Chilliwack, you should steer clear of thatch roofs (fire danger, no proper attachment) and aging flat membranes without proper ballast systems (leak risk, wind uplift). Steeply sloped cedar shakes and brittle slate also deliver poor results due to fragility and fastener limits. Significant snow weight and powerful gusts heighten dangers. Select engineered mounting on metal standing seam or newer asphalt; structural analysis and membrane enhancements resolve most restrictions.

    How Do Snow and Moss Affect Panel Performance Here?

    Snow accumulation and moss growth both diminish output. Snow accumulation may reduce output by 80–100% until it falls off; black-framed panels, slippery glass, and a 30–40° angle aid snow removal. Yield decreases 5–15% from moss shading due to blocked sunlight and hotspot development. Mitigation involves anti-reflective coatings, hydrophobic treatments, adequate spacing, and string wiring that reduces mismatch. Implement bypass diodes, supervise string-level information, prune nearby branches, and organize gentle yearly cleanings with approved biocide.
